JAKARTA - SNSD's Taeyeon shared a fan statement asking SM Entertainment for an explanation regarding the cancellation of the idol's single concert in Japan.
On April 17, SM Entertainment announced through Taeyeon's official website that the cancellation of the TENSE concert which was supposed to be held on 19 and 20 at the Tokyo Ariake Arena. The agency explained that the tools used for Asian tours did not arrive in Japan on time, making it difficult to hold concerts on schedule.
A Japanese concert a few days after Taeyeon's concert in Jakarta on April 12. However, they did not explain whether there was a new date for a concert in Japan.
A day later, Taeyeon wrote a message for fans through a fan platform by writing, "When I heard of the cancellation of a Japanese concert, I was very worried about my fans and felt disappointed."
"I don't like this situation and I feel guilty for my fans. Performances made with hard work and expectations are taken instantly and I don't know how to express this empty and sad feeling," he said.

On April 24, Taeyeon re-shared an official statement from the Taeyeon fan group asking SM Entertainment for an explanation regarding the cancellation of the concert.
In that statement, fans criticized SM Entertainment for the cancellation two days before the concert and the agency's failure to communicate with fans.
In addition, no official statement was released via Taeyeon's social media considering that many fans from outside Japan had already traveled. Plans to replace concerts in Japan were also not delivered.
"We warn of a situation where mistakes can be directed at artists related to artists, as we take care of artists to avoid criticism for communicating directly to fans," Taeyeon's fan group said globally.
Citing The Qoo, SM Entertainment responded to the statement with, "We are not preparing any statement."
Taeyeon itself is still continuing the tour of The TENSE to several countries, namely China, Singapore, Thailand, and Hong Kong.
